Rock drill tools come in various types and sizes, each designed for specific drilling needs. Some common types of rock drill tools include pneumatic rock drills, hydraulic rock drills, and electric rock drills. Pneumatic rock drills are powered by compressed air and are commonly used in mining and construction industries. Hydraulic rock drills are powered by hydraulic fluid and are ideal for drilling hard rock formations. Electric rock drills are powered by electricity and are suitable for drilling in confined spaces.

The design of a thread drill bit is a marvel of engineering. Its point angle and flute design are optimized for chip removal, ensuring a clean hole while preventing the bit from jamming or clogging. The cutting edges are precisely ground to produce the desired thread pattern when the drill bit is run through a material at the appropriate speed and feed rate. The result is a thread that is accurate, consistent, and ready for immediate use without additional finishing processes.
